'''
Created on 15 june, 2018
@author: sp977u@att.com (Satish Palnati)
This class is for starting process to create threads and kick start process.
We validate the model class data and prepare correct sets . once we have correct data, we can call respective functionality.
we instantiate Service classes under service network package.
'''
from PySide import QtCore,QtGui
from service_network.pingLogprocess import PingProcessor
import os
import time
import datetime
import threading
from views.ping.ping_window import PingWindow
class PingEngine:
quit_flag = False
def __init__(self,common_model,last_parent):
self.totalcount = 0
self.common_model = common_model
self.signalcount = 0
self.threadPool = QtCore.QThreadPool()
self.lock = threading.Lock()
self.threadPool.setMaxThreadCount(48)
self.last_parent = last_parent
self.ping_wind = PingWindow(last_parent) # to prepare GUI ping components for right base layout
def start_ping_engine(self):
#self.close_right_child_widgets()
#self.ping_wind.main_widget.show()
self.date_time = datetime.datetime.strftime(datetime.datetime.now(), '%d-%m-%Y %H:%M:%S').replace(':','-')
if self.common_model.valid_ip_flag == 'Green':
try :
os.makedirs(self.common_model.output_path + "\\"+ self.date_time) # put folder name as per view selected
self.PingLogfile_path = self.common_model.output_path + "\\"+ self.date_time + "\\ping_log.txt"
self.PingLogfile_hand = open(self.PingLogfile_path,'w+')
self.PingLogfile_hand.write("Valid IP : " + str(len(self.common_model.final_ip_list)) + "\n\n")
self.PingLogfile_hand.write("InValid IP : " + str(len(self.common_model.invalid_ip_list)) + "\n\n")
self.PingLogfile_hand.write("Duplicate IP : " + str(len(self.common_model.duplicate_ip_list)) + "\n\n")
except TypeError :
self.common_model.output_path = self.common_model.output_path.decode('utf-8')
os.makedirs(self.common_model.output_path + "\\"+ self.date_time)
except Exception as uex:
print("error:", uex)
print( 'unable to create output folder. Please check the disk space or permissions!')
#log to file
#pop-up
return 0
self.ping_wind.prepare_window()
self.ping_wind.cancel_button.clicked.connect(self.cancel_all)
self.ping_wind.progressBar.setValue(0)
for ip in self.common_model.final_ip_list:
self.qtcmd = PingProcessor(ip, self.common_model.output_path + "\\" + self.date_time +"\\",len(self.common_model.final_ip_list),'True',self.PingLogfile_hand,self)
self.qtcmd.finishedProcessing.connect(self.pingbarUpdate)
self.threadPool.start(self.qtcmd)
def pingbarUpdate(self,totalcount,ip_status):
try:
if self.ping_wind.wind_close_flg == True:
self.quit_flag = True
self.last_parent.base_left.go_button.setDisabled(False)
self.lock.acquire()
self.signalcount +=1
self.ping_wind.progressBar.setValue(self.signalcount*100/totalcount)
self.ping_wind.progressBar.show()
#self.ping_wind.setWindowFlags(QtCore.Qt.WindowCloseButtonHint)
if ": Down" in ip_status:
ipstatus = ip_status.replace(": Down",'')
self.ping_wind.down_ip_textbox.appendPlainText(ipstatus)
elif ": Up" in ip_status :
ipstatus = ip_status.replace(": Up",'')
self.ping_wind.up_ip_textbox.appendPlainText(ipstatus)
elif "Cancelled" in ip_status:
self.ping_wind.progressLabel.setText("Ping log process is being Cancelled, Please wait ....!")
# self.threadPool.waitForDone()
#print("Current active : ",self.threadPool.activeThreadCount())
pass
#self.ping_wind.down_ip_textbox.appendPlainText(ip_status)
if self.signalcount >= totalcount:
self.ping_wind.progressBar.hide()
self.ping_wind.progressLabel.hide()
self.last_parent.base_left.go_button.setDisabled(False)
self.ping_wind.cancel_button.hide()
# if "Cancelled" in ip_status:
# self.last_parent.msgBox.information(None,'Job status!',"Ping logs process has been cancelled.!", QtGui.QMessageBox.Ok)
# self.signalcount = 0
if self.quit_flag == False:
self.last_parent.msgBox.information(self.last_parent.gui,'Job status!',"Ping logs have been completed, Please check the log file..!", QtGui.QMessageBox.Ok)
elif self.quit_flag == True and self.ping_wind.wind_close_flg == False:
self.last_parent.msgBox.information(self.last_parent.gui,'Job status!',"Ping logs process has been cancelled.!", QtGui.QMessageBox.Ok)
self.signalcount = 0
#self.ping_wind.setWindowFlags(QtCore.Qt.WindowMinimizeButtonHint)
self.quit_flag = False
self.lock.release()
except Exception as uexx:
print("Unwanted error : ", uexx)
def cancel_all(self):
self.quit_flag = True
self.ping_wind.cancel_button.hide()
# print("Current active threads are : ",self.threadPool.activeThreadCount())
self.qtcmd.cancel_sig.emit("Cancel Job")
#self.last_parent.msgBox.information(None,'Job status!',"Ping logs process has been closed.!", QtGui.QMessageBox.Ok)
